Course structure

• Introduction to Diet and Sleep Quality
• The Science of Sleep: Stages, Cycles, and Functions
• Nutritional Foundations for Optimal Sleep
• Impact of Macronutrients and Micronutrients on Sleep
• Sleep Disorders and Dietary Interventions
• Chrononutrition: Timing Meals for Better Sleep
• Gut Health and Its Connection to Sleep Quality
• Lifestyle Factors: Exercise, Stress, and Sleep Hygiene
• Personalized Nutrition Plans for Improved Sleep
• Case Studies and Practical Applications in Diet and Sleep Optimization
